I sit here out of Africa
Around me some are from America
Many more are from Australia
Few others are from Asia
And if look around some are from Europe

We came here some tied up by rope
Others unconcious from dope
You walk by, and you gaze at me
Your children are frigtened of me
I do not belong here
I want to go home

Some say it is best I stay here
Because there are not many of me left
What did I do to hurt you
For you to take me away from my home
Everyday, you bring food to me
I have to take it, because you
Will not release me to get my own

I am not like you
I do not dress up and have bills to pay
I do not waste the earth's resources
The way you have done
Since the Industrial Revolution.
I do not try to wage wars
I never left this earth
To get to Mars
I am of this earth and plains
I roamed just for survival

Why then have you locked me up
In Zoo's and laboratories
Let me go home to where I belong
You can still come and see me
I am better in the wild
Because I am free.
